M-way shut as bridge is installed
A stretch of motorway on Tyneside has been closed over the bank holiday weekend to allow a new pedestrian and cycle bridge to be lifted into place.

The Newcastle Central Motorway will be closed until Tuesday morning to allow the Northumbria University structure to be lifted into place by cranes.

It is shut between the New Bridge Street roundabout and Jesmond Road.

Motorists have been warned to avoid the area and diversions and signposts have been put in place.

The northbound diversion takes motorists from the motorway along to New Bridge Street to Clarence Street Stoddart Street, Portland Road, Sandyford Road, Osborne Terrace and Jesmond Road before rejoining the motorway.

Southbound traffic is diverted from the motorway to Jesmond Road, Portland Terrace, Portland Road, Stoddart Street, Clarence Street and New Bridge Street before rejoining the motorway.
